Employment law firms are legal practices that specialize in matters pertaining to employment law. These firms typically offer a wide range of services, including legal advice, representation in negotiations and litigation, and drafting of employment contracts and policies. Whether you are an employer looking to ensure compliance with labor laws or an employee seeking to protect your rights in the workplace, an experienced employment law firm can provide the guidance and support you need to navigate the legal landscape.
One of the key roles of employment law firms is to help employers understand and comply with the myriad of laws and regulations that govern the employer-employee relationship. Employment laws are constantly evolving, and failure to adhere to these laws can result in costly lawsuits, fines, and damage to your company’s reputation. By working with an employment law firm, employers can stay abreast of changes in the law, ensure compliance with labor standards, and protect their business from legal liabilities.
For employees, employment law firms play an essential role in protecting their rights and interests in the workplace. Whether you are facing discrimination, harassment, wrongful termination, or other labor-related issues, an employment law firm can provide the legal expertise and advocacy you need to seek justice and fair treatment. By working with an employment law firm, employees can hold employers accountable for violations of labor laws and ensure that their rights are upheld.
